It's been a while since I have looked at options for a skimmer for an IM Nuvo Fusion 20. Had a Ghost skimmer before, but wasn't super impressed, low skimmate production, and it decreased over the years. I heard a couple years ago that they were revamping it, but any listing I see for the Ghost doesn't look any different from before. Is that the new gen ghost being sold these days and does it work any better? Any other suggestions for skimmers that do fit? The Icecap K1 nano was looked like a possibility for me and was looking like it may fit, but they're sold out everywhere. I'm not real keen on retrofitting for a Tunze 9001 if I don't have to, I would like to find something to just drop in. I don't care about looks as far as the skimmer goes, just that it functions. If I can't find anything, I'd be open to looking into HOB skimmers. Never tried one, but if there's one someone was really impressed with I'd be open to suggestions. Been runnning skimmerless for a while now and the tank is sliding, want to get it back to where it was, so any help is appreciated. Even if the consensus is to throw in the towel and go Tunze! :p

I hate to say this, but stay away from any IM skimmer. For what you get they are insanely overpriced. The collection container is a horrible design and will leak/bubble over constantly (making a mess), it's noisy (including the pump) and the cheap Chinese pump will fail in under 6 months - rendering the whole thing useless. I know some have had good success with the Tunze (with some modifications in the rear sump area).
